1. Mastering Language Nuances in English
In the PSLE, the English paper tests a wide range of skills, from situational writing to the intricacies of the “Synthesis and Transformation” section. Primary 6 English tuition focuses heavily on helping students refine their writing voice and expand their vocabulary. Tutors provide structured frameworks for planning compositions, ensuring that students can produce coherent and engaging stories within the time limit. Furthermore, tuition helps students identify common traps in the grammar and vocabulary MCQ sections. By practicing with past-year papers and simulated exams, students become familiar with the level of precision required to score well. This intensive focus on language application ensures that students can express their ideas clearly and accurately, which is essential for success across all components of the English exam.
2. Tackling Complex Concepts in Science
Science at the Primary 6 level requires a deep understanding of diversity, cycles, systems, interactions, and energy. Primary 6 Science tuition is particularly valuable for helping students navigate the “Open-Ended” section, which many find the most challenging. Tutors teach students how to identify the underlying scientific concepts in a question and how to structure their answers using the correct keywords. This often involves mastering the Claim-Evidence-Reasoning (CER) technique, which is vital for securing full marks. Additionally, tuition programmes often use visual aids and hands-on demonstrations to make abstract concepts more tangible. This not only improves retention but also fosters a genuine interest in the subject. When students understand the “why” behind the facts, they are much better prepared to handle unfamiliar questions in the actual exam.
3. Building Exam Stamina and Time Management
One of the most overlooked aspects of the PSLE is the physical and mental stamina required to sit through multiple papers. Tuition centres provide a controlled environment for students to practice full-length mock exams. These sessions help students learn how to manage their time effectively, ensuring they do not spend too long on a single difficult question. For instance, in Primary 6 English tuition, students learn how much time to allocate for the planning, writing, and checking phases of their composition. Similarly, in science, students learn to pace themselves through the multiple-choice section to leave enough time for the more demanding written part. This familiarity with the exam rhythm reduces anxiety and allows students to perform at their peak during the actual PSLE.
